Factor Xa in complex with the inhibitor 2-[[4-[(5-chloroindol-2-yl)sulfonyl]piperazin-1-yl] carbonyl]thieno[3,2-b]pyridine n-oxide

Contents

Overview

Compound 7 was identified as the active metabolite of 6 by HPLC and mass, spectral analysis. Modification of lead compound 7 by transformation of, its N-oxide 6-6 biaryl ring system and fused aromatics produced a series, of non-basic fXa inhibitors with excellent potency in anti-fXa and, anticoagulant assays. The optimized compounds 73b and 75b showed sub to, one digit micromolar anticoagulant activity (PTCT2). Particularly, anti-fXa activity was detected in plasma of rats orally administered with, 1mg/kg of compound 75b.

About this Structure

2D1J is a Protein complex structure of sequences from Homo sapiens with CA and D01 as ligands. Active as Coagulation factor Xa, with EC number 3.4.21.6 Full crystallographic information is available from OCA.
